Founder and operations manager of the Museum of Engines and Mechanisms (University of Palermo). Member at the museums system committee (University of Palermo). Planned and personally carried out the conservation/full restoration of the 300+ artifacts in the museum collection. Organized and managed 40+ cultural events, temporary exhibits, and technical conferences.Member of the Fluid Machinery and Applied Mechanics research group at the University of Palermo, his main research activities focus on internal combustion engines with homogeneous charge compression ignition (HCCI) and double fuel combustion. Co-author of several scientific papers and co-editor of the book Essays on the History of Mechanical Engineering (Springer International, 2016).Member of the national culture committee of the Automotoclub Storico Italiano (Italian Federation of Classic Vehicles Clubs, part of FIVA). Graduated in mechanical engineering at University of Palermo (Italy) in 2009, where obtained his Ph.D. in Energetic in 2014.
